HomeMy WebLinkAbout1981-06-01 MinutesMINUTES OF A FIREMEN'S PENSION AND RELIEF BOARD MEETING A meeting of the Firemen's Pension and Relief Board was held on Monday, June 1, 1981, at 4:30 p.m. in the City Manager's Office, City Administration Building, Fayetteville, Arkansas. PRESENT: Treasurer Scott Linebaugh, Members Paul Logue, Ralph Tate Larry Freedle, Robert Johnson, John Dill; City Manager Grimes, and Secretary Vivian Koettel. ABSENT: None MINUTES The minutes of the May 4, 1981 meeting were approved as submitted. PENSION LIST There were no additions or deletions to the pension list, and a motion was made and seconded to approve the pension list for June. The motion passed unanimously. OLD INVESTMENTS Treasurer Linebaugh reported that certificate #10766 had been deposited with First Federal at 18.05% interest for 182 days, to mature on November 9th. The amount is $212,395. Motion was made and seconded to approve this certificate. Motion passed unanimously. NEW INVESTMENTS Treasurer Linebaugh reported that there were no investments coming due the month of June. The next one would be due July 20 and then July 27. The first one is for $211,000 and the other for $145,000. Both of these will be taken care of at the next meeting. OTHER BUSINESS Discussion was held on receiving input from City Attorney Jim McCord on what action was necessary concerning some of the bills passed by the State legislature City Manager Grimes stated he would ask McCord to send a memo outlining the necessary procedures and steps to be taken.
